On a school trip to a theme park, four busses each carry 175 students.
15% of the students are bringing their own lunch.
1/7 of the students are buying lunch when they get to the theme park.
The teachers are worried that some students have not made plans for lunch.
Find how many students have not made plans for lunch.

Answers

Answer:

495 students.

Step-by-step explanation:

Four buses each carry 175 students.

So,

Total Students =:4 × 175 = 700

Students who brought lunch =:15% of 700

= 15/100 × 700

= 105

Students who will buy lunch when they get to theme park = 1/7 × 700

= 100

So,

Students who don't have plans for lunch = 700 - 105 -100

= 495
